I'm going to start a mailing list for my website and I'm concerned about my users' privacy (regarding their addresses, contents not allowed, etc.. I'm kind of new to these things). Is there any document/policy I can read about this topic?

The laws and acts that governs data protection and emailing various from country to country, while a lot of them change from country to country most say among the same thing and you will need to learn the key points of these and its far to many to list but for example. Not keeping peoples data on file for more than 2 years, you are responsible for safe keeping of their data and may be liable for leaked/hacked information if your not taking responsible measures.

Google is your best friend for learning the various laws and acts in various countries on this subject and there's just to many results to list them here.

Also to add to this. If you use a reputable mailing list company (such as Mailchimp or Constant Contact) they will help you with the guidelines. The other important point that I think often gets overlooked is that in general you can only use the persons details for purpose for which it was given. So if someone signs up for one reason that is the only reason you can use their information. – joesk Feb 12 at 13:02
